Game developers embed certified random number systems into their applications, ensuring each spin, deal, or roll generates autonomous results. The systems create millions of numbers per second, establishing results when users initiate decisions.
Anti-fraud platforms monitor transaction patterns to recognize suspicious operations. Machine learning systems evaluate deposit rates, withdrawal amounts, and geographic areas to identify possibly deceptive operations. Danger assessment tools assign scores to exchanges, activating personal evaluations when thresholds are crossed.
Game applications and content developers
Specialized firms create gaming content that casino on-line providers incorporate into their platforms. These providers build slots, table games, and live dealer activities utilizing proprietary production systems. Each vendor operates exclusive servers that store game data and process gameplay mechanics autonomously from provider infrastructure.
Incorporation happens through application programming connections that create interaction connections between casino platforms and supplier systems. Users launch titles that run on supplier architecture while their records and balances stay handled by the casino on-line system.

Two principal categories exist: pseudo-random number systems and hardware-based genuine random number generators. Pseudo-random mechanisms apply mathematical formulas initialized with unpredictable inputs to form number patterns. Hardware solutions derive unpredictability from tangible processes such as electronic noise, yielding authentically variable outcomes.
